I found out the new technique, one of the member posted here. It was about writing down everything(or important things) in waking life at the end of the day before bed. So yesterday i wrote down everything i remember in that day and went to sleep 30 minutes earlier.
So i had a dream where i was running at my grandmothers apartment. I was inside the house, then i saw some strange things etc.
So it was non sense all throughout the dream. But then I am like : wait i must see my hands. They pop up really fast, and they are normal. Then i put them down, and look at them once more. As they were falling out of my view, i noticed that i have like normal hand with smaller fingers in between the normal fingers. Im like : Woah!. And i started to feel the sense of power.
Then i saw a lot of people running towards me(like attacking, but they were normal people). I stretched out my hand and said : "Dissapear from here !" They all vanished like dust. So then i said, i must move to a blank, plain white infinite room( that was one of my tasks, when i get lucid), so I appeared there, but i woke up.
SO at this point, im not really sure if i did understand that i was dream or not, inside the dream, or was I just dreaming that i realized that i am dreaming.
This has happened to me like 3rd time now, and I'm never sure if I'm lucid or not. Or maybe I'm lucid but the vividness or dream control is not as high as it could be.
Also this was the longest "successful reality check" dream. In the first one, i FA after 5 seconds, then in second one i lasted for like 15 seconds. Now it felt like over 30 seconds.
